INTERACT FORUM

Please login or register.

Login with username, password and session length
Advanced search  
Pages: [1]   Go Down

Author Topic: Resource Drain with 1.4 million file library [Solved -- virus checker problem]  (Read 2283 times)

Zootsuit

  • World Citizen
  • ***
  • Posts: 139
  • too cool for school

I know this topic has come up before, and I've tried to research anything helpful in other threads, but the closest I came was a posting by Laserwolf in the bug-reporting thread for 18, so at Jim H's suggestion, I'm starting a new thread..

In previous builds, I've noticed some drain on resources, but nothing that disrupted my use of MC. I installed 18.0.78 about a week ago, and immediately began experiencing a major drain on the memory every time MCwas open. It began immediately, decreased somewhat when I initially minimized it, but then began ramping up again, to the point where both the computer and MC became unusable.That required  either that I terminate the program, or in several cases, the program froze and I had to reboot.

My primary computer has 6 gigs of memory, and taskmaster would routinely showing 1 g or more of usage by MC. There was no corresponding spike in processor utilization. The problem was particularly acute when I was working in Chrome with MC in the background, but it wasn't limited to that. I haven't experienced a similar problem on the two clients that connect to the MC server; quite often, the server remains open for lengthy periods of time, when I'm traveling or working, but the problem occurs even before I open the server..

I've tried running MC headless, but nothing changes. I took note of the suggestions about antivirus conflicts, and ultimately removed Avast, or as much of it as I could (with Revo Uninstaller). Without Avast, MC's memory usage remained between 250-325 gs, but I couldn't leave the computer naked (obviously), so tried installing MSE and began experiencing the same issues.

My system info follows. As you can see, there are lots of external drives, although I'm not sure that's relevant. Also, I have a very large library scattered amongst the drives, something on the order of 500 K files totaling 10 TB - lots of duplicates. I've excluded information on the external drives - too lengthy - but can provide that if relevant:

Media Center
    Install Path: C:\Program Files (x86)\J River\Media Center 18\
    Interface Plugins: TiVo Server (running)
    JRMark: never run
    Library: 1386929 files, 180 MB in library, 6.2 GB in thumbnails
    Resources: 198 MB memory, 320 handles
    Version: 18.0.78.0 Registered
Bluetooth Radios
    Broadcom Bluetooth USB with AMP (driver 6.3.0.2500)
    Microsoft Bluetooth Enumerator (driver 6.1.6002.18457)
Bluetooth Virtual Devices
    Bluetooth AV (driver 6.3.0.2400)
    Bluetooth Hands-free (driver 6.3.0.2400)
    Bluetooth Headset (driver 6.3.0.2400)
    Bluetooth L2CAP Interface (driver 6.3.0.2200)
Computer
    ACPI x64-based PC (driver 6.0.6002.18005)...
Display adapters
    NVIDIA GeForce 9500 GS (driver 7.15.11.7556)
DVD/CD-ROM drives
    TSSTcorp CDDVDW TS-H653Q (driver 6.0.6002.18005)...
Human Interface Devices
    Bluetooth Remote Control (driver 6.3.0.2400)...
Logitech USB Wheel Mouse (driver 6.1.6002.18005)
    Microsoft eHome Infrared Transceiver (driver 6.1.6002.18005)...
IEEE 1394 Bus host controllers
    AGERE OHCI Compliant IEEE 1394 Host Controller (driver 6.0.6002.18005)
Imaging devices
    EPSON Perfection V33/V330 (driver 3.9.1.3)
Keyboards
    HID Keyboard Device (driver 6.0.6002.18005)
    HID Keyboard Device (driver 6.0.6002.18005)
    Microsoft eHome MCIR 109 Keyboard (driver 6.0.6002.18005)
    Microsoft eHome MCIR Keyboard (driver 6.0.6002.18005)
    Microsoft eHome Remote Control Keyboard keys (driver 6.0.6002.18005)
Memory
    Free Physical Memory: 3.5 GB
    Total Memory: 6.0 GB
Mice and other pointing devices
    HID-compliant mouse (driver 6.0.6001.18000)
    HID-compliant mouse (driver 6.0.6001.18000)
    Logitech USB Wheel Mouse (driver 6.0.6001.18000)
Modems
    PCI Soft Data Fax Modem with SmartCP (driver 7.74.0.0)
Monitors
    Generic Non-PnP Monitor (driver 6.0.6001.18000)
Network adapters
    802.11n Wireless PCI Express Card LAN Adapter (driver 2.0.4.0)
    Bluetooth Device (Personal Area Network) (driver 6.0.6001.18000)
    Realtek RTL8168C(P)/8111C(P) Family PCI-E Gigabit Ethernet NIC (NDIS 6.0) (driver 6.203.214.2008)
Network Infrastructure Devices
    Microsoft Wireless Router Module (driver 1.0.0.3)
Operating System
    Microsoft Windows Vista 64-bit
Portable Devices
    USB CF Reader    (driver 6.0.6002.18112)
    USB MS Reader    (driver 6.0.6002.18112)
    USB SD Reader    (driver 6.0.6002.18112)
    USB xD/SM Reader (driver 6.0.6002.18112)
Printers
    Canon Inkjet PIXMA iP4000 (driver 6.0.6000.16386)
Processors
    Intel(R) Core(TM)2 Quad CPU    Q6700  @ 2.66GHz (driver 6.0.6001.18000)
    Intel(R) Core(TM)2 Quad CPU    Q6700  @ 2.66GHz (driver 6.0.6001.18000)
    Intel(R) Core(TM)2 Quad CPU    Q6700  @ 2.66GHz (driver 6.0.6001.18000)
    Intel(R) Core(TM)2 Quad CPU    Q6700  @ 2.66GHz (driver 6.0.6001.18000)
Sound, video and game controllers
    Bluetooth Hands-free Audio (driver 6.3.0.2400)
    Hauppauge WinTV HVR-1800 (Model 78xxx, Combo ATSC/QAM) (driver 1.27.26077.0)
    Realtek High Definition Audio (driver 6.0.1.5591)
Storage controllers
    Intel(R) ICH8R/ICH9R SATA RAID Controller (driver 7.6.0.1011)
    Microsoft iSCSI Initiator (driver 6.0.6002.18005)
Logged

Matt

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 42372
  • Shoes gone again!
Re: Resource Drain in MC 18
« Reply #1 on: December 11, 2012, 01:14:02 pm »

    Library: 1386929 files, 180 MB in library, 6.2 GB in thumbnails

With 1.4 million files in the library, I think you're going to have to expect heavy memory usage.  Other programs would die long before this.

If there are specific actions that are slow, we might be able to work to improve them.

Logged
Matt Ashland, JRiver Media Center

Zootsuit

  • World Citizen
  • ***
  • Posts: 139
  • too cool for school
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#2 on: December 11, 2012, 01:43:56 pm »

That's odd - MC reported there are @520 K files in library, including duplicates. Never noticed the discrepancy.  :o

But to the point - why would this behavior manifest itself only when an antivirus program is running? I suppose I could dump MSE and try AVG or Pandora.

Logged

Matt

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 42372
  • Shoes gone again!
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#3 on: December 11, 2012, 01:49:23 pm »

@File count
Create the smartlist ~d=a and take a look.  What are all the extra entries?  Adding the expression column FileDBLocation() may help.  If something isn't getting cleaned up properly, it'd be good for us to find and fix it.


@Anti-virus
They hook the process and Windows API, so can, at least theoretically, screw just about anything up.

Make sure you exclude your library folder from any real-time scanning.  If the virus checker wants to virus check the *.jmd library files every time they're touched, it's going to be bad.
Logged
Matt Ashland, JRiver Media Center

Arcturus

  • World Citizen
  • ***
  • Posts: 106
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#4 on: December 11, 2012, 04:34:39 pm »

It's easy in MSE to simply have it ignore all of JRiver's processes. So no need to dump anything. IF that really is causing you any issue at all its trivial to fix.

Logged

HTPC4ME

  • Regular Member
  • Citizen of the Universe
  • *****
  • Posts: 2760
  • LIFE IS A RADIO... CRANK IT UP TO 11!
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#5 on: December 11, 2012, 05:21:36 pm »

zoot, i have 780,000 in mine never had problems with virus checkers im using MSE. But last few months I have had 2-3 minute lock ups when searching audio files (version 17), and when clicking on Year tag... basically making jriver server and all clients useless. last night i installed 18, and rebuilding whole library so far at 764,000 files when i goto Audio and do a search files are showing up instantly, and when i click on year that is allowing me to click on it without any lockups... My scenario i'm leaning towards was a corrupt library. i did try restores BACK to where i knew lockups were not happening and that did not fix the problem.

I've always had MANY runtime errors with jriver when doing a full import throughout the years, but i must admit on 18 and being this is my first library build on it im quite impressed only 1 runtime error so far, but i've yet to hit thumbnail building, it will be interesting to see how many runtime/BSOD i get once thumbnail building kicks in... Typically for 780,000 files i get 8-10 Runtime/Lockups/BSOD's when building thumbs.

also just any fyi. i have 6 pc's that all use essentials and connect to server... no files on clients. and have 16GB ram

Quote
It's easy in MSE to simply have it ignore all of JRiver's processes. So no need to dump anything. IF that really is causing you any issue at all its trivial to fix.
could i please get insturctions on this easy process? maybe it will stop my runtime and BSOD when building... be an interesting test at least.

After writing this... thumbnail building has started and im at 6936 of 780371 and my processes for media center is at 1,086,396k, cpu is at 18%
Logged

StFeder

  • MC Beta Team
  • Citizen of the Universe
  • *****
  • Posts: 1493
  • Fight! You may win. If you don't, you already lost
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#6 on: December 11, 2012, 05:33:09 pm »

For Windows8:
Hit the windows button and start typing "Windows Defender" at the start screen. You'll get a link to Windows Defender. Open it.

For Windows Vista/7:
Double click the MSE Icon (the small green/red house) in the taskbar to open MSE.

In MSE:
Go to settings. You'll see entrys named "Excluded files & locations", "Excluded file types" and "Excluded processes".

I've added my library location, the MC Program Folder and the MC subfolder at users to my excluded locations. If added all exe files in the MC program folder to excluded processes plus MC18.exe at C:\Windows\System32.

Not sure if this is true for Windows Vista/7, but for Windows 8 be sure to hit "Add" after typing/selecting something in the above box. It should be listed in the lower box than. Hit "Save changes" after adding all exclusions.

I did this, because longer time ago (perhaps MC14) I had some serious problems connected to my AntiVirus tool.
Logged

Matt

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 42372
  • Shoes gone again!
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#7 on: December 11, 2012, 05:36:35 pm »

xtacbyme, if you have a crash, please start a thread with details and provide a log from Help > Logging.

Thanks.
Logged
Matt Ashland, JRiver Media Center

HTPC4ME

  • Regular Member
  • Citizen of the Universe
  • *****
  • Posts: 2760
  • LIFE IS A RADIO... CRANK IT UP TO 11!
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#8 on: December 11, 2012, 05:44:55 pm »

StFeder Thanks.

Matt will do... first runtime error while adding files logging wasn't enabled :( so i've enabled it and will report when thumb crash happens. Thanks.
Logged

Zootsuit

  • World Citizen
  • ***
  • Posts: 139
  • too cool for school
Re: Resource Drain in MC 18 with 1.4 million file library
« Reply #9 on: December 12, 2012, 07:00:38 am »

After substituting MSE for Avast, I rebooted and now usage seems normal, stabilizes between 275 and 325 and plays very smoothly. Search still shows a little hesitation, but less than before. :)

StFeder, thanks for suggestion, I've already excluded all possible audio-video file types, will now do it by location to be doubly sure.

xtacbyme, I'll be interested to see what happens with the thumbnails. 

Matt, will 2X the file count. That's an odd discrepancy.
Logged
Pages: [1]   Go Up